About Accounting And Finance, Bsc (hons) in Swansea University

Accounting and Finance at Swansea University is 8th in the UK and 1st in Wales for Graduate Prospects (Complete University Guide 2021).

Become a highly skilled, career-ready graduate when you study our multi-accredited, BSc Accounting and Finance degree.

Not only will you get a head start to achieving Chartered Accountant status with global accrediting bodies - ACCA , ICAEW and CIMA, but you will also study a huge selection of topics from Management Accounting and Financial Accounting to Corporate Finance.

Our course is designed to ensure you are taught the most relevant, cutting-edge topics- which will make you stand out from other candidates in the job market.

You will gain both the technical and practical skills needed to thrive in the world of accounting and finance; and will have the opportunity to complete a zero-credit module- designed to guide you through an entire process of setting up a computerised accounting system- using SAGE Line 50. This invaluable practical know-how and your vast knowledge of both accounting and finance will give you a serious edge when you graduate from Swansea University.

YOUR ACCOUNTING AND FINANCE EXPERIENCE

Accounting and Finance at Swansea is a flexible degree with the chance to study abroad for a year, or work in industry for a year. This can give you a real competitive advantage and will broaden your horizons when it comes to seeking employment.

Your Accounting and Finance experience will benefit from a wide selection of optional modules in later years of study, allowing you to shape the degree towards your career goals.

Teaching at Swansea is partly informed by research, and our staff have hands-on experience of theory and practice, meaning you can benefit from their academic expertise and real-world know-how.

As well as setting you up for a career as an accounting and finance specialist, within a business or organisation, we also have support services available to help you start your own business. This is particularly useful for those students wanting to become independent accountants or financial advisors.

During your time with us, you will also have full access to our cutting edge video and digital content creation suite and state-of-the-art facilities at the School of Management, including the Fujitsu Innovation Hub and presentation rooms.

Non-native English speakers must achieve 6.0 overall with no component less than 5.5 in IELTS or equivalent tests.

Candidates are expected to have achieved 70% Year XII  including Standard XII in English - 70% or above (or equivalent).
